
Eric Weiss, age 55, is an independent director of Core Scientific (since January 2024) serving on the Compensation and Nominating and Corporate Governance committees. He holds an MBA from Columbia Business School.
Weiss began his career as a US Government bond trader at Morgan Stanley Dean Witter, then progressed through private equity and venture capital roles. He was a Director in GE Capital's Private Equity and Venture Capital Division focused on internet investments, subsequently joined Internet Capital Group (ICG) as a Director of investments in B2B internet companies and Board representative for portfolio companies, and later served as founding Principal at Stripes, leading investments in online direct marketing.
Since October 2017, Weiss has been founder and Chief Investment Officer of Blockchain Investment Group LP, a hedge fund of funds focused exclusively on blockchain assets. He purchased his first bitcoin in December 2013 and has been an active investor in hedge funds for over 20 years. He serves as a director of OranjeBTC (OBTC3.SA), a Brazilian publicly traded bitcoin holding company, and previously served as a director of Kindly MD, Inc. (NASDAQ: NAKA) until September 2025.
